Understanding Progressive Claims And Car Insurance

Progressive, as a company, has long established itself as a reliable insurance provider for all sorts of personal and commercial requirements. What many people as consumers may not fully understand and appreciate, though, are the intricacies of ‘progressive claims’ – the process by which policyholders submit a claim to the insurer to access coverage promised under the terms of their policy.

The Genesis of Progressive Claims

Progressive claims can originate from a whole host of situations such as auto accidents, home damage, or incidents involving recreational vehicles. Typically, the process commences with the policyholder reporting the incident to the insurer. From there, the company investigates the incidence to validate the claim. At the conclusion of a successful investigation, the insurer pays out the claim, subject to the terms and conditions defined in the policy.

Dealing with Car Insurance Claims

A significant proportion of progressive claims are tied to auto insurance. If a policyholder’s vehicle is involved in an accident, they would typically first ensure the safety of all involved parties. After that, they would contact emergency services as required, make a note of the accident scene details, witness information, and then report the incident to Progressive. The company then sends a claims representative or an adjuster to investigate the event and estimate the repairing cost.

Why Should You Compare Car Insurance Green Slip?

Among the various types of car insurance options out there, comparing car insurance green slips is a keen focus area for many consumers. The ‘Green Slip,’ more formally known as Compulsory Third Party (CTP) Insurance, is mandatory for Australian vehicle owners. It provides coverage for injuries caused to other people in an accident, including pedestrians, cyclists, and other road users.

As auto insurance costs continue to shoot up, it becomes more critical than ever to ensure that you are not overpaying for your CTP Green Slip. Different providers can have remarkably different rates based primarily on the risk profile they associate with the insured. When reviewing the ‘Green Slip,’ factors such as the driver’s age, location, driving experience, and history are all taken into consideration along with the make, model, and usage of the car. All of these dimensions can have a significant influence on the cost of your CTP cover.

Therefore, it is advisable to regularly contrast and compare your car insurance ‘Green Slip’ with those offered by other providers. It is not uncommon for motorists to find out that they can get a similar, if not a better deal, from a different service provider. Health Insurance Guide

Health has always been uncertain. We can try our best to keep fit, but after a certain age the expenses on health do increase. Its better to keep ourselves insured under a Medical Plan to make sure that our medical expenses are taken care of.If we talk about Individual Health Insurance Plans in US, they are designed to help an individual and their families access care and cover the medical cost of receiving medical services from any physician, hospital or other provider.There are different types of Medical Plans: Indemnity Health Maintenance Organization Preferred Provider Organization Point of Service Plan Exclusive Provider Organization Consumer-DrivenHealth Insurance Portability and Accountability Act (HIPAA) Privacy Protected Health Information.Under HIPAA Privacy, unauthorized individuals cannot ask or inquire about any clinical or personal health information when counseling participants about their Medical Plans.Indemnity Plans These plans are sometimes called Free-for-Service Plans, where: An individual pays the medical care provider directly for services Files claim to be reimbursed by the PlanAn Individual can seek care from any doctor or hospital and receive benefits.Hospital precertification is required for some services in order to receive the highest level of benefits.This plan: Pays reasonable and customary deductible coinsurance amounts, up to an out-of-pocket maximum Rely on Utilization Management to control costsHealth Maintenance Organization (HMO) An HMO provides prepaid benefits for most health care needs with no bills or claim forms. It provides services through a selected group of doctors, hospitals and other providers who are under contract to the HMO. To choose an HMO option, an individual must live or work in an area supported by the HMO network as defined by their home ZIP Codes. An individual choose a Primary Care Physician (PCP) from a list of physicians They pay copayment (instead of deductibles) each time they visit a provider Services rendered by the PCP or from a provider referred by PCP is reimbursed HMOs provide preventive care and rely on Utilization Management to control costsPreferred Provider Organization (PPO) A PPO is a network of contracted participating physicians and hospitals that agree to render their services at discounted rates.PPOs maintain networks of participating doctors and hospitals; however, individuals are not required to choose a PCP to coordinate their care. They have the choice of using in-network and out-of-network providers, using in-network providers offers higher benefits though.Point of Service Plan (POS) POS Plans have networks of participating doctors and hospitals that provide medical care at negotiable rate. Individuals living in a POS service area, according to their home ZIP Codes, are eligible to join the plan and must choose an in-network PCP or facility from the list of providers Using in-network providers offer the highest level of benefitsExclusive Provider Organization (EPO) EPO Plan resembles to HMO. Benefits are provided within a specific contracted network of physicians and hospitals with no out-of-network benefits available. Individual chooses a PCP from the list of physicians Individual are required to pay a predetermined copayment (instead of a deductible) each time they visit a provider. Services rendered by PCP or by a provider referred by the PCP will be reimbursed EPOs provide preventive care and rely on Utilization Management to control costs

Cool Car Accessories For Teens

By Levi Quinn

Getting the first car as a teenager is among the most exhilarating experiences in a teenager’s life. Unfortunately, though, most teenagers will usually not have a sleek new-looking car as their first rides. Since the teenager will likely get a car that is a bit old or second-hand, chances are that you want to have the car supped up a little bit to make it look presentable. There are many gadgets and car accessories on the market that can give that old car a nice finish that will leave passersby taking a second and possibly a third glance at what they have done to the car. Some of these add-ons are relatively cheap and can be bought using the meager monthly allowances.

One of the coolest gadgets that will add some life to the old ride is the audio gear road trips. These wireless FM transmitters will make car CD changers look obsolete. These add-ons are capable of scanning and tuning to the clearest FM station within range. In addition, they can be connected wirelessly to an iPod. It makes it not only easy to play iPod music in the car but also allows a rapid charging of the iPod. Of course, everybody wants LCD screens in the car. Some LCD screens come with portable DVD players making them excellent additions to the car’s entertainment. A good portable DVD player will usually have a number of screens that can be positioned throughout the car. However, on a teenager’s budget, going for one LCD screen is enough.

Another of the cool additions is installing a scrolling license plate frame. These gadgets allow a person to personalize up to five messages using a wireless remote controller. Thus, one can tell the driver behind them about their favorite sports team or even advertise an upcoming event or business to other motorists. One can do so many wild things with this addition. It is like changing the mood on the road and letting the people around know about it. This amazing plate frame can be bought for less that $70. Other additions can also be placed around the license plate to make it look more glamorous.

A car’s audio system will likely be the most outstanding feature of any car. From a distance, it will alert everyone that a smart car is coming his or her way. There are many units on the market that offer stability and endurance to a car’s audio. The two most common speaker systems for a car are Kenwood and Pioneer sound systems. The options of playback are numerous. Pricing is largely based on the number of options a system will have. Most of the speakers from these two manufacturers have proven their worth on the market. Combined with the LCD functionality, these sound systems are definitely worth the investment to put into them. Having a plug power inverter will make the addition of the above and other devices not only easier but also safe while on the road. With less than $200, a teenager can make their car look new again.

Air Freight Agent Dealing With All Business Delivery Requirements

Many duties are included whenever an air shipping delivery must be organized. Directing the shipment to its destination is just one responsibility of an agent. These experts must find service providers who are able to move the freight to the needed destination and arrange the necessary space for the shipping. An air freight agent receiving a customer booking also has the responsibility of arranging pre-flight pick-up and post-flight delivery details.

The delivery needs to be weighed for the appropriate transport expenses to be determined. A broker may arrange all required paperwork, for example the shipping bill, after this information is available. Delivery payments may be accepted at this point in the process. All documents are processed so the suitable info can be included with the shipment.

The work of a broker does not stop at completion of the transportation plans. Duties extend to informing the shipper of all flight delays, unloading incoming shipping, informing the client of shipment arrival, and organizing shipping. International transport services include extra documents for customs, for example the industrial bill. Paperwork varies dependent on the destination. Any company delivering a critical freight load or extensive shipment can benefit from the services of a broker because they decreases delivery mistakes and provides much better overall prices.

The Every Day Responsibilities of Freight Agencies

Shipping companies have set limitations on the types of items they are prepared to carry for their customers. Most don’t allow the importation or exportation of goods banned by a particular nation. Weight limitations can be part of these types of regulations dependent on the cargo they are dealing with. Extra weight may lead to the inability to supply the service or extra delivery costs.

Agencies offering both air and vehicle services can usually choose the shipping up at the customer area or a nearby warehouse. Area, time constraints, along with other elements may impact this type of servicing. In some instances, immediate pickup or delivery won’t be an choice. Delivery discount rates are sometimes provided whenever a business needs to carry big cargo.

Air transportation is a superb solution when items are time-sensitive or must be shipped to a more isolated location. It’s the fastest transport method accessible and highly effective for shipping items to any location in the world. Trustworthy freight agencies work hard to satisfy their clients. They try to arrange all carries in favor of both the customer as well as the freight air carrier.

Airlines shipping these items should have a business model that encourages easy procedures to fulfill their customer demands. Agents combine all moving processes for efficient goods transport to the scheduled destination. Their efforts ensure freight gets to the predetermined time in the anticipated condition.

Substantial knowledge about items transportation assists these professionals in answering all client inquiries and provides the most dependable choices. They are able to go over insurance charges, delivery particulars, as well as tracking techniques thoroughly to make certain a company understands what is happening concerning their shipment. A business selecting to use the providers of qualified air freight brokers will be stress-free and assured of a safe delivery process due to the services provided.

The Rules Of Life Insurance Policy Delivery

By Dennis Jarvis

So what happens when you’re approved for a life insurance plan that you applied for? The good news is that you’re approved. We now go into the phase known as policy delivery. There are some important tips to remember here and although each carrier is a little different in their requirements (we’ll help you with your particular life insurance company), some common threads run through them. Let’s look at how life insurance policies are delivered.

First, it’s important to understand how the life insurance contract works. When you submit your application, this is called the “offer”. Essentially you are making an offer to the carrier based on your pertinent information for a given rate. The carrier then decides whether to accept, decline, or change this offer (i.e. change the rates). At this point, the carrier will deliver you a policy. You do not officially have coverage until you return this policy back with your confirmation of its terms. This is important. You do not want to go through the entire application, paramedical exam, and underwriting process only to delay or possibly void the life insurance coverage due to mishandling this final confirmation. Let’s look at what is generally acknowledged and confirmed by you after policy delivery.

Common requirements for you, the applicant:

1) Acknowledgement of premium assigned. You need to confirm the rate that has been offered. Keep in mind, it might be different than original due to health status, paramedical, and underwriting results.

2) Acknowledgement of effective date or a request to update new effective date. This is important since effective date dictates when your coverage (and your payment) starts.

3) Contract policy review with agent for understanding of terms. Make sure to go through any question or contract terms with us as your licensed life insurance agent.

4) Copy of your application enclosed with policy. Keep this for your record.

5) Deadline for receipt of signatures. This is very important to make sure your policy goes into effect. You must return the signed contract by this date.

6) Premium payment (can be check, or electronic auth.) if not already submitted. Auto deduction and/or credit card can be a safer way to pay since there’s no “lost in the mail” scenarios that can jeapardize your coverage.

7) Premium modal frequency decision verified. This is where you decide to pay annually, quarterly, monthly, etc. Your premium modal can affect your rate (with shorter periods being more expensive)

8) Acknowledgement of policy delivery signature. You are acknowledging that you did in fact receive the policy.

9) Tax certification- some carriers want you to verify whether or not you are subject to backup witholding due to underreporting of interest or dividends.

10) Age change- if youve had an age change during the process,instructions are provided. You may/may not be able to lock premium rate by keeping effective date prior to birthday. Please contact if you’re straddling two ages so we can find the best rate and value.

The main take-away is that there is a time constraint. You can’t set this policy info aside and get to it in a few weeks or assume you were approved and therefore, have coverage. You have to acknowledge and confirm with the carrier once the policy is received and do so before the deadline.
